Product Detailed Parameters

  • Description:CAP ALUM 2700UF 20% 100V SCREW
  • Series:LSW
  • Mfr:Rubycon
  • Package:Bulk
  • Capacitance:2700 µF
  • Tolerance:±20%
  • Voltage - Rated:100 V
  • ESR (Equivalent Series Resistance):-
  • Lifetime @ Temp.:3000 Hrs @ 105°C
  • Operating Temperature:-40°C ~ 105°C
  • Polarization:Polar
  • Ratings:-
  • Applications:General Purpose
  • Ripple Current @ Low Frequency:3.4 A @ 120 Hz
  • Ripple Current @ High Frequency:3.74 A @ 10 kHz
  • Lead Spacing:0.500" (12.70mm)
  • Size / Dimension:1.417" Dia (36.00mm)
  • Height - Seated (Max):2.598" (66.00mm)
  • Surface Mount Land Size:-
  • Mounting Type:Chassis Mount
  • Package / Case:Radial, Can - Screw Terminals

Application Scenarios

Rubycon 100LSW2700MEFC36X63 in the Aluminum Electrolytic Capacitors category is typically selected when engineers need predictable, spec-driven behavior in a production design. In real deployments, engineers typically derate voltage and validate thermal rise because lifetime is typically determined by core temperature in the enclosure. In real deployments, they provide energy storage and decoupling, shaping impedance versus frequency to stabilize rails and signal paths. Selection depends on ESR/ESL, ripple current, temperature behavior, dielectric stability, and lifetime under stress. Across telecom and data center power, impedance and ripple margins influence stability in dense, high-current boards. In compact devices, layout-driven ESL and placement can dominate performance, so practical design rules matter. In real deployments, across industrial power supplies, bulk capacitance smooths rectified rails and provides ride-through during short brownouts in hot cabinets.
